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 03/08/2016, à 09:55

Compte anonymisé

[Ubuntu 16.04] 127.0.1.1 (en tant que DNS et proxy) , pourquoi faire ?

Bonjour.
En manipulant mes services avec systemd, je me suis trouvé avec ce retour de commande de systemctl status NetworkManager.service

NetworkManager.service - Network Manager
   Loaded: loaded (/lib/systemd/system/NetworkManager.service; enabled; vendor preset: enabled)
   Active: active (running) since mar. 2016-08-02 16:40:21 CEST; 25min ago
 Main PID: 7021 (NetworkManager)
   CGroup: /system.slice/NetworkManager.service
           ├─2054 /usr/sbin/dnsmasq --no-resolv --keep-in-foreground --no-hosts --bind-interfaces --pid-file=/var/run/NetworkManager/dnsmasq.pid --listen-address=127.0.1.1 --cache-size=0 --proxy-dnssec --enable-dbus=org.freedesktop.NetworkManager.dnsmasq --conf-dir=/etc/NetworkManager/dnsmasq.d
           ├─7021 /usr/sbin/NetworkManager --no-daemon
           └─7082 /sbin/dhclient -d -q -sf /usr/lib/NetworkManager/nm-dhcp-helper -pf /var/run/dhclient-enp0s3.pid -lf /var/lib/NetworkManager/dhclient-24697a9b-4964-49ac-b317-e3fbb7326a66-enp0s3.lease -cf /var/lib/NetworkManager/dhclient-enp0s3.conf enp0s3

On distingue ici que NetworkManager démarre avec dnsmasq avec l'option --proxy-dnssec et l'option --listen-adress=127.0.1.1 où 127.0.1.1 est inscrite par défaut dans /etc/hosts et dans /etc/resolv.conf .
Sachant qu'apparemment, Ubuntu a besoin d'un serveur DNS externe pour accéder à Internet et résoudre les noms, si il y a un serveur DNS interne à Ubuntu, à quoi cette configurations spécifique sert-elle ?
Merci de m'éclairer smile .

#2 Le 03/08/2016, à 11:32

Compte supprimé

Re : [Ubuntu 16.04] 127.0.1.1 (en tant que DNS et proxy) , pourquoi faire ?

Ne serait-ce pas un cache DNS pour accélérer la navigation ?

#3 Le 03/08/2016, à 11:46

Compte anonymisé

Re : [Ubuntu 16.04] 127.0.1.1 (en tant que DNS et proxy) , pourquoi faire ?

Quand je vois ça : --cache-size=0 je ne pense pas à un cache DNS.

#4 Le 03/08/2016, à 14:34

Compte supprimé

Re : [Ubuntu 16.04] 127.0.1.1 (en tant que DNS et proxy) , pourquoi faire ?

Désactiver la fonctionnalité DNS de dnsmasq
Apparemment ça sert aussi de DHCP…

#5 Le 03/08/2016, à 16:53

Compte anonymisé

Re : [Ubuntu 16.04] 127.0.1.1 (en tant que DNS et proxy) , pourquoi faire ?

J'ai bien compris ce que c'était mais ce que je veux savoir, c'est à quoi sert une telle configuration sur Ubuntu ?
Sachant que sur d'autres distros, le seul DNS suffisant pour une utilisation client internet est celui pointé par l'adresse de la 'route par défaut'.

#6 Le 03/08/2016, à 17:33

Compte supprimé

Re : [Ubuntu 16.04] 127.0.1.1 (en tant que DNS et proxy) , pourquoi faire ?

Peut-être autrefois pour s'affranchir des corruptions DNS des box ?

Dernière modification par Compte supprimé (Le 03/08/2016, à 21:55)

#7 Le 03/08/2016, à 22:00

Compte supprimé

Re : [Ubuntu 16.04] 127.0.1.1 (en tant que DNS et proxy) , pourquoi faire ?

#8 Le 16/11/2017, à 07:12

Jaurug

Re : [Ubuntu 16.04] 127.0.1.1 (en tant que DNS et proxy) , pourquoi faire ?

Bonjour,
le client BT Transmission est à l'origine de nombreuses instances de dnsmasq.
J'ai écrit un script dsnsTest.sh qui les comptes régulièrement.
Le maximum est de 21 instances de dnsmasq simultanées.

Quand il y a 21 instances de dnsmasq démarrées, Firefox ne sait plus naviguer sur le web, il n'arrive pas à faire les résolutions de noms. Et dans un terminal, une commande sudo, met un certain temps avant de proposer la saisie du mot de passe.

Comme palliatif, j'ai ajouté dans dnstest.sh, un "killall dnsmasq", qui se déclenche au-dessus de 19 instances.

Les problèmes liés à dnsmasq sont apparus sur le serveur après l'installation de openvpn et l'usage des scripts de nordvpn.
À+

Hors ligne

#9 Le 03/01/2018, à 16:25

fred1234

Re : [Ubuntu 16.04] 127.0.1.1 (en tant que DNS et proxy) , pourquoi faire ?

"Les problèmes liés à dnsmasq sont apparus sur le serveur après l'installation de openvpn et l'usage des scripts de nordvpn."

Avec Windscribe

je suis en dual boot : Win10 et Linux.
J'ai utilisé Windscribe sous Win et sous Linux.
Après usage, l'adresse DNS passe à 127.0.1.1, ce qui ne me permet plus de connexion internet sous Linux.
Quel que soit l'Os utilisé pour ce VPN.
Je suis obligé de modifier cette adresse manuellement (127.0.0.53 d'origine).

Problème identique ?

Hors ligne